Procedure Language

Description: The Procedural Language is a programming language specifically designed for creating stored procedures and functions within database management systems. This type of language allows developers to write blocks of code that can be stored and executed on the database server, optimizing performance and efficiency of operations. Through the Procedural Language, users can implement complex logic, perform calculations, and manipulate data directly in the database, thus reducing the need to transfer large volumes of data between the server and client applications. This approach not only improves execution speed but also facilitates the management of data security and integrity. Among its main features are the ability to handle control structures such as loops and conditionals, as well as the possibility to define variables and custom data types. In summary, the Procedural Language is a fundamental tool for developing robust and efficient applications that interact with databases, allowing developers to optimize their processes and enhance the end-user experience.
